Manchester United's Premier League Opener: No Place for Jadon Sancho

In a surprising turn of events, Manchester United opened their Premier League campaign against Fulham without Jadon Sancho in their lineup. This decision came as a shock to many fans and analysts, given that manager Erik ten Hag had reportedly resolved earlier issues with the 24-year-old winger. Sancho's exclusion sparked immediate speculation about his future at the club and potential interest from other European giants like Paris Saint-Germain and Chelsea.

The context surrounding Sancho's absence adds another layer of intrigue. Sancho had returned to first-team training in July after a prolonged hiatus, making his first competitive appearance since September 2023 in the Community Shield against Manchester City. However, his return was marred when he missed a vital penalty in the shootout, a moment that may have influenced Ten Hag’s decision for the Premier League opener.

Sancho's Return and Recent Form

Sancho's journey back to the squad was notable for its challenges. His absence for most of the previous season had been the subject of much debate, with various reports citing both physical and mental health concerns. Fans were optimistic when he resumed training in July, seeing it as a sign of better days ahead. However, his performance in the Community Shield, especially the missed penalty, may have hindered his immediate return to regular play.

The match against Fulham saw Antony being selected over Sancho to fill the winger position on the bench. Antony’s selection was indicative of Ten Hag’s preference for players who are perhaps seen as being more in form or reliable at this moment.

New Signings & Tactical Decisions

Another crucial aspect of the match was the debut of United’s new defensive signings, Noussair Mazraoui and Matthijs de Ligt. Mazraoui started the match, adding a new dimension to United’s backline, while de Ligt was named on the bench. These new additions align with Ten Hag’s strategy to bolster the defensive line, indicating a shift towards a more robust defensive approach.

The game itself concluded with a narrow 1-0 victory for Manchester United, courtesy of Joshua Zirkzee's goal in the 87th minute. Zirkzee's impactful performance after coming off the bench in the 60th minute highlighted the importance of strategic substitutions and hinted at the squad depth available to Ten Hag.

Speculations Surrounding Sancho’s Future

Sancho’s lack of involvement has inevitably led to increased gossip about his future with Manchester United. Given his past reputation and talent, it's unsurprising that clubs like Paris Saint-Germain and Chelsea have shown interest. Speculations are rife, but without any official statements, it's all conjecture at this stage.

Erik ten Hag, in his post-match comments, emphasized the necessity of rotation and maintaining the bench's balance. He assured that despite Sancho’s absence from this particular match, all players would get opportunities as the season progresses. However, the anticipation of his return or possible departure remains an ongoing talking point.
